Report- Shikha Shreya
Ranchi, Chamguru village is situated at a distance of 25 km from Ranchi. Where goats live 10 times more than humans. Goats will be seen welcoming you as soon as you enter this village. Also, wherever you look, you will find only goats. Because goat rearing is done in every house here. In this village, 90 percent of the households run from goat rearing. Chamguru village has also been adopted by Birsa Agriculture University.
Vimla Devi, a resident of the village, says that the university has adopted it, which facilitates goat rearing. Earlier it used to be very difficult to arrange medicine and food for the goat. But due to the cooperation of the university, we do not face much trouble.

a thousand people and 10,000 goats
At the same time, Lalmohan, a resident of the village, says that there are about 300 houses and 1000 people live in this village. But talking about goats, its number is more than 10,000. Because here in every house you will find 30 to 45 goats. Everyone from small children to elders in the house graze goats. Because this is the livelihood.
Vimla Devi interrupts Lalmohan and says that small children should go to school properly. But the poverty is so much that even if you don’t want to, you have to send it to the farm along with the goat. Why goat rearing and doing some other business, Vimla Devi says that we have no idea about anything else. From the beginning, we only know goat rearing and we have been doing the same. What else will you do if you don’t keep goats?
Everything from marriage to studies is done by selling goats.
Irfan Ansari of the village says that in our village everything from marriage to education of children is done by selling goats. Goat is the ATM machine for us. Goats are sold when money is needed.
Goats are mostly sold in the market and people buy them from home on the occasion of marriages and festivals. More sales happen on the occasion of festivals. Goats are sold by weight.
The head of the village, Sunil, says that it is our endeavor to give them more business information with the help of Birsa University. But due to the lack of education, people are still holding the goat.
Professor Ashok of Birsa Agricultural University says that the people of the village know goat rearing. That’s why we help them in gathering all the resources for goat farming. Along with this, we are providing them detailed information about many schemes of the government.
